2001/11/01

06:54 UT  S West	Bright front along wide bright streamer, 
			slow loops follow

08:30 UT  W Limb	Bright front to N of previous event

09:30 UT  S Pole	Faint narrow front along diffuse streamer

14:06 UT  S East	Fast wide bright front fills quadrant, cavity
			and core follow, then much trailing material.
			Streamers disrupted to N and S. M3 and M1 flares 
			in AR9687 on SE limb

22:30 UT  Partial	Very narrow front just discernible in N West, 
	  Halo		spans ~200 deg by 23:30. Possible very faint 
			extensions over E limb. Further fronts follow.
			M1 flare and EIT eruptive prominence AR9682

2001/11/02

06:06 UT  N East	Faint narrow ragged front
